注意:如果传入的是普通变量,反射对象是不可修改的;要修改字段,需传入指针并解引用。
如何追踪一个请求从开始到结束的所有日志,是异常分析的重中之重。
挑战:版本号比较的复杂性 标准的版本号格式(如语义化版本2.0.0)通常包含主版本号、次版本号、修订号以及可选的预发布标识和构建元数据。
36 查看详情 public function apply() { $data = session()->get('processed_form_data'); // 从 Session 获取数据 if ($data) { session()->forget('processed_form_data'); // 数据使用后可以从 Session 移除 return response()->json([ 'status' => 'success', 'message' => 'Data retrieved from session and applied.', 'data' => $data ]); } return response()->json(['status' => 'error', 'message' => 'No processed data found in session.'], 404); }3.2 Redirect with Flashed Session Data(重定向闪存数据) Laravel中非常常见且优雅的模式,用于在重定向后立即获取一次性数据。
* 在实际应用中,你可能需要根据用户或其他条件加载地址。
从 C++17 起,推荐使用 <filesystem> 中的 std::filesystem::remove 函数跨平台删除文件,它在文件存在且删除成功时返回 true,不存在则返回 false 但不抛异常,需用 try-catch 处理权限等错误;对于旧版本 C++,可使用 <cstdio> 中的 std::remove,返回 0 表示成功,但错误处理能力弱,无法区分文件不存在与权限问题,建议优先采用 std::filesystem::remove。
所以,结构体完全可以胜任资源管理的角色,只要你遵循RAII原则,并合理处理拷贝/移动语义。
如果链表中存在环,快指针最终会追上慢指针;如果没有环,快指针会到达链表末尾。
如何配置?
挖错网 一款支持文本、图片、视频纠错和AIGC检测的内容审核校对平台。
示例: NameGPT名称生成器 免费AI公司名称生成器,AI在线生成企业名称,注册公司名称起名大全。
确认当前XML文件的实际编码 在转换之前,先要确定XML文件的真实编码格式。
只要类型拥有接口中所有方法,就被认为实现了接口。
立即学习“C++免费学习笔记(深入)”; 初始capacity由构造方式决定,可能为0或某个小值 每次扩容都会触发一次内存重新分配和元素拷贝,开销较大 可通过reserve(n)提前设置capacity,避免多次扩容 shrink_to_fit()可请求释放多余容量(是否生效取决于实现) 合理使用reserve可以在已知数据规模时显著提升性能。
为什么C++推荐大量使用const关键字?
*: 匹配前一个字符零次或多次。
services.php 配置不正确: 问题: config/services.php 文件中的 mailgun 配置没有正确读取 .env 变量。
这个指针决定了切片能访问到哪个数组的哪个位置。
我们再次使用array_reverse()将其恢复到原始的逻辑顺序。
在 Laravel 中,这通常通过一个中间(枢纽)表来实现。
本文链接:http://www.futuraserramenti.com/486623_400518.html